Roberta “Robbi” Arlene Winters, age 82, of Rancho Palos Verdes, CA passed away Monday, February 5, 2024. Born on April 15, 1941 in Chicago, Illinois to Robert and Marie Winters, and raised in Benton Harbor Michigan. The family moved West to California, and Robbi graduated from Arcadia High School in 1959. She found her dream career as a flight attendant working first with TWA on Trans Atlantic flights to Europe, then with Western Airlines to be based closer to home in California. For 25 years she flew the skies, loving every minute of it, and even talked about going back to flying long after retirement. She was also a proud SAG card holder and did voiceovers for a time. Robbi’s talents and interests were many, she was an amazing singer, guitarist, and pianist, and all around entertainer. She had the greenest thumb, designed and made some of her own clothes, and she cooked with heart for those she loved, and boy did she know how to throw a party!! She was a member of Sweet Adelines chorus in Torrance, CA, and a quarter of a Barber Shop Quartet, Red Dye #5. She was a proud member and participant of the AAUW and Readers Theater with several community performances around the South Bay. In her later years Robbi enjoyed spending time with her family and being the best dog mom to her pampered pooch, Bijou. Preceded in death by her parents Robert and Marie Winters.
